Opposition stalls business demanding Deputy Speaker's resignation
Bhubaneswar, Aug 22 (UNI) Pandemonium prevailed in Orissa Assembly today forcing Speaker Kishore Mohanty to adjourn the house twice and then for the day as the Opposition stalled the proceedings right from the Question Hours, demanding resignation of Deputy Speaker Prahallad Dora following an FIR against him in a dowry torture case.
The Opposition Congress trooped into the well, shouted slogans and snatched away Speaker's microphone demanding the resignation of the Deputy Speaker.
Mr Mohanty, who failed to pacify the agitated Opposition, adjourned the House at 1044 hours to till 1130 hours without transacting any business. The House reassembled at 1130 hrs but was adjourned again till 1200 hours.
The Speaker then announced that the Business Advisory Committee would sit at 1700 hours today to decide the issue and adjourned the House, finally, for the day to be resumed on Monday amidst slogan shouting by the Congress members.
As the House commenced for the day to take up the question hours, Congress Chief Satya Bhusan Sahu, rising on a point of order quoted a news paper report on FIR filed against Mr Dora by his daughter-in-law alleging dowry torture.
Mr Sahu said in view of the FIR, Mr Dora stands as an accused and unfit to occupy the Deputy Speaker post to conduct the business of the House.
Demanding the resignation of Mr Dora, the Congress chief said the business of the House should not be taken up till the Deputy Speaker resigned.
Congress member Tara Prasad Bahinipati said an FIR had already been lodged against Mr Dora in the dowry torture case but he was opposed by BJP member Maheswar Sahu, who made certain allegations against Mr Bahinipati.
This led to a commotion in the House and the Opposition Congress trooped into the well shouting slogan disrupting the business.
